About
GrimGrimoire allows players to take on the role of Lillet Blan, a young magician who is admitted to a prestigious and mystical magic school; however, on the fifth day of school, everyone mysteriously vanishes. Lillet awakens the next day to discover she is once again living out the first day of school; but her memories from the previous days are intact, giving her the opportunity to solve the mystery behind the disappearances and prevent the tragedy from occurring.
What players say
A console RTS wrapped in Vanillaware's lush hand-drawn art and a charming time-loop story, with approachable rune-and-familiar tactics. Well-liked but a commercial flop, giving it a quiet cult and hidden-gem reputation.
